Why Is Biphenyl Formed As A By Product In A Grignard Reaction?

WebJan 16, 2016 · Truong-Son N. Jan 16, 2016. Some biphenyl can form if not all of the phenyl bromide has already reacted with magnesium solid to form the Grignard reagent. WebOne of the responses of apple trees to ARD is the formation of biphenyl and dibenzofuran phytoalexins in their roots. However, there is no information on whether or not these … WebNov 12, 2024 · The formation of biphenyl skeleton initiates with benzoyl-CoA as the starter substrate, which is condensed with three molecules of malonyl-CoA in a reaction catalyzed by the enzyme biphenyl synthase (BIS, Fig. 1) (Liu et al. 2004) to form the first biphenyl backbone 3,5-dihydroxybiphenyl.
